Bitcoin Enters Deep Bear Market Zone Despite a Google Search Trends Spike

Bitcoin Bear Market Zone conditions are drawing renewed attention as Google Trends data aligns with sharp price volatility and cautious investor behavior across global markets.

Retail Search Activity Rises During Price Stress

Bitcoin Bear Market Zone dynamics became visible as Google search interest surged to its highest level this year. Search scores reached 100 during a rapid price decline from roughly $81.5k to near $60k.

This pattern reflects heightened retail attention during moments of sharp market stress. Retail investors often seek clarity when price movements accelerate within a short timeframe.

Search activity suggests fear-driven information gathering rather than structured investment planning. Such behavior commonly appears during volatile phases across previous Bitcoin market cycles.

Market observers on X noted that spikes in online interest frequently accompany uncertainty.
These posts described rising searches as reactions to fear, uncertainty, and doubt.

The commentary framed search behavior as a response to sudden price dislocation.

Price Compression Signals Extended Bear Conditions

The Bitcoin Bear Market Zone is further reflected through the Mayer Multiple Z-Score readings. Current levels sit below minus 0.9, placing Bitcoin well under its long-term average.

Historically, similar conditions aligned with extended consolidation rather than immediate reversals. The chart structure shows muted price action following prior market peaks.

This environment limits momentum and sustains hesitation among both new and experienced participants. Price compression tends to test conviction rather than reward early positioning.

Sentiment Remains Muted as Conviction Is Tested

Within the Bitcoin Bear Market Zone, sentiment remains restrained across trading communities. Confidence appears limited as investors assess whether declines represent a correction or a continuation.

This uncertainty keeps participation cautious and trading volumes selective. Historical data shows similar zones often preceded trend changes after extended stagnation.

However, these periods rarely provide clear signals during early formation stages. As a result, many participants remain on the sidelines awaiting confirmation.

Recent X commentary described this phase as uncomfortable and quiet. Such messaging reflects long-standing behavioral patterns seen during deep Bitcoin bear cycles.
